Mixon's Injury and the Bengals Offense

Introduction: Mixon's injury highlights the delicate balance of the Bengals offense. His ability to run effectively and catch passes makes him a unique and irreplaceable asset. Understanding his role and potential replacements is crucial.

Key Aspects

  • Mixon's Role: He is the primary ball carrier and a reliable pass-catching option. His versatility creates significant challenges for defenses.
  • Potential Replacements: Samaje Perine and Chris Evans would likely share the workload in Mixon's absence.
  • Offensive Scheme: The Bengals have a strong passing game with Ja'Marr Chase, Tee Higgins, and Tyler Boyd. The offense's success is heavily dependent on Mixon's ability to establish the run.
  • Impact on Playcalling: The offensive coordinator may need to adjust the playcalling, potentially relying more heavily on the passing game.

Discussion: While the Bengals have experienced depth in the running back position, Mixon's unique skillset is irreplaceable. Perine and Evans are capable backs, but they lack Mixon's explosiveness and pass-catching ability. The Bengals would need to adapt to a more pass-heavy offensive approach, which may require a greater reliance on their passing game.
